Olga Bonfiglio is a professor at Kalamazoo College in Kalamazoo, Michigan, and author of Heroes of a Different Stripe: How One Town Responded to the War in Iraq. She has written for several national magazines on the subjects of food, social justice and religion. She currently volunteers as a summer/winter gardener and LaMancha goat handler on a small farm in southwest Michigan.
